                          • Originally posted by kantu View Post
                            @All
                            what is the correct way to measure oil level
                            With dip stick fully closed ? Because I get only half reading when I just dip it i.e without closing it and full reading when closed completely
                            In the owners manual it is said to wipe the dip stick clean and thread it in, take it out and then note the reading. So, just dipping might not suffice.

                            Make sure the bike is placed on central stand and ground level is even. Check oil level after waiting for 5 mins.

                            • guys went to test exhaust performance this sunday on a empty strech .
                              some points i got to know

                              1. bike pulls magnificently in mid rpms (4k to 7.5k)..(even stock pulls in this rpm band , ffe has just increased the pull )
                              2. there is lot of torque improvement in bike.
                              3. my bike start to vibrate more on higer rpm. above 7.5k rpm there is lot of vibration which was less on stock exhaust. may be bike needs some tuning..
                              4. its been 3 months and 2300kms since last service.(tapplets neeeds to adjust they are making a lot of noise)
                              5. i have not tuned the bike after the airfilter alteration (done more than 500 kms after change) . bike must be running lean(symptoms heavy vibs on higher rpms)
                              6 airfilter alteration: i have altered the stock air filter to increase air flow.
                              i have removed the airfilter cap (which has smaller dia air intake opening) and putted a plastic ring on inner foam opening it increase its diameter and sealed the rest with the cello tape so that no air is sucked from surroundings of filter.
                              now filter retains its filteration(more than k&n) and has increase the flow of air.
                              and their comes sweet air induction sound from filter box when throttle is pulled suddenly.
